A588 Carbon Steel Coil is a high-strength, low-alloy structural steel that is particularly suited for applications where improved atmospheric corrosion resistance is a priority. This steel is often used in construction projects for its durability and ability to withstand harsh environmental conditions. The alloying elements in A588 enhance its resistance to corrosion, making it an ideal choice for structures exposed to moisture and varying weather conditions.
One of the primary advantages of A588 Carbon Steel Coil is its excellent weldability. This property allows it to be easily fabricated and incorporated into various structures without compromising its structural integrity. Additionally, the steel’s inherent strength makes it suitable for use in a variety of structural applications, including bridges, buildings, and high-rise constructions. Its lightweight nature compared to other structural steels can also reduce the overall weight of a construction project, contributing to cost savings in foundation requirements.
Another important aspect to consider is the aesthetic appeal of A588 Carbon Steel Coil. When exposed to the elements, this steel develops a distinctive weathered appearance as it forms a protective layer of rust. This characteristic not only enhances the visual aspects of structures but also reduces the need for maintenance and repainting, as the protective layer inhibits further corrosion.
When planning a construction project, it’s vital to consider the environmental impact of the materials used. A588 Carbon Steel Coil is often regarded as a sustainable choice because of its recyclability. Steel can be recycled multiple times without losing its properties, making it an environmentally friendly option in the construction industry.
